Gout is One of the more painful sorts of arthritis, which is caused by the persistent elevation of uric acid inside the bloodstream, bringing about major existence of crystal formation from the joints, tendons and bordering tissues. It typically takes place in those people who are consistently consuming red meat and beer. Thus, internationally pain has actually been labeled into three significant classes—nociceptive pain, neuropathic pain and inflammatory pain [one]. Primarily, equally the CNS and PNS are involved with the system and pathways of all variants of pain perception. The PNS comprises nerves and ganglia that can be found outside the house the brain and spinal cord, mostly functioning to connect the CNS to organs and limbs in our overall body. Conversely, the CNS is composed of the spinal wire and also the brain, which is especially accountable for integrating and intepreting the data despatched with the PNS, and subsequently coordinating the many actions within our bodies, before sending reaction in the direction of the effector organs.

Right here we located that very long-term injection of morphine in mice results in the morphine metabolite M3G accumulation, which activates ERK1/two by way of APLNR and finally activates the discharge of microglia and inflammatory variables TNF-α, IL-oneβ, and IL-seventeen, exacerbating NCP. These results increase to our knowledge of the purpose of APLNR in pain and spotlight the crucial mechanisms of morphine tolerance. We also identified that M3G binds to your MOR and activates ERK1/2, Together with activating ERK1/2 by APLNR. Morphine has two metabolites: M3G and morphine-six-glucuronide (M6G). M6G binds on the opioid receptors and exerts analgesic effects. M3G has very low affinity for opioid receptors and may be involved in the event of morphine tolerance 38. Experiments confirmed that M3G can activate ERK1/2 and microglial proliferation to some extent. In comparison with this, the effect of M3G binding and acting with APLNR is more evident; consequently, it might be hypothesized that in morphine tolerance, M3G may possibly act far more via APLNR and only a little bit or as a result of MOR to some extent.
